Understanding ADHD Private Assessment in the UK: A Comprehensive Guide
Attention Deficit Disorder (ADHD) is a neurodevelopmental condition that affects both children and adults. Although frequently identified in youth, ADHD can continue into their adult years, affecting numerous aspects of life, consisting of education, work, relationships, and psychological health. In the UK, lots of people seek private assessment for ADHD, planning to obtain a comprehensive evaluation and proper support. This post looks into the intricacies of ADHD private assessments in the UK, covering what the process requires, its advantages, and often asked questions.
What is ADHD?
ADHD manifests in 3 main presentations:
Predominantly Inattentive Presentation: Characterized by troubles in preserving attention and following through on jobs.Primarily Hyperactive-Impulsive Presentation: Features excessive movement, impulsive decision-making, and high activity levels.Integrated Presentation: A mix of both inattentive and hyperactive-impulsive signs.Symptoms of ADHD
ADHD symptoms can vary widely among individuals however normally consist of:
Inattention:
Difficulty sustaining focus in jobsEasy distraction by extraneous stimuliDifficulty arranging tasks and activities
Hyperactivity:
Fidgeting or tapping hands or feetProblem remaining seated in situations where it is anticipatedRunning or climbing in inappropriate circumstances
Impulsivity:
Interrupting othersDifficulty awaiting one's turnMaking choices without considering consequencesUnderstanding the Need for Private Assessment
While adhd evaluation assessments can be acquired through the National Health Service (NHS), numerous people go with private assessments due to a number of factors:
Reasons to Consider a Private AssessmentDecreased Waiting Times: The NHS can have lengthy waiting lists for assessment, whereas private assessments are frequently performed faster.Comprehensive Evaluations: Private specialists may use more extensive testing and make use of a variety of assessment tools.Customized Support: Collected information during private assessments can lead to more customized treatment alternatives and assistance mechanisms.Confidentiality: Some people may seek more confidentiality in a private assessment setting.The ADHD Private Assessment Process
Understanding the private assessment procedure can help individuals browse the journey successfully. Here are the main steps included:
Step-by-Step ProcessStepDescriptionInitial ConsultationA consultation where the private discusses their issues and symptoms.Comprehensive EvaluationA series of standardized tests assessing attention, habits, and cognitive function.History TakingCollection of medical, developmental, and family history to support the assessment.Feedback SessionResults are discussed with the person, including diagnosis and suggestions.Ongoing SupportOptions for therapy, training, or medication may be proposed based upon the results.Kinds Of Assessments Used in ADHD EvaluationBehavioral Assessments: Tools like the Conners 3rd Edition or ADHD Rating Scale.Cognitive Testing: Assessments to evaluate IQ and executive functioning.Questionnaires and Surveys: Self-report instruments or reports from caregivers.Clinical Interviews: Direct discussions with the specific to assess symptoms and problems.What to Expect After the Assessment
Following the assessment, people will get an extensive report detailing the findings and suggestions. Possible next steps may include:
Discussing treatment options, such as behavior modifications or medication.Establishing coping strategies for managing symptoms.Referrals to support groups or educational resources.FAQs About ADHD Private Assessment in the UKQ1: How much does an ADHD private assessment normally cost?
A: The cost of a private ADHD assessment can differ commonly however typically varies from ₤ 400 to ₤ 1200, depending upon the company and particular requirements of the assessment.
Q2: Is a diagnosis received at the end of the assessment?
A: Yes, people normally get a diagnosis or feedback based on the evaluation procedure, including symptoms and habits patterns.
Q3: Can adults be assessed for ADHD?
A: Yes, adults seeking assessment can go through the same strenuous evaluation procedure as children, as ADHD can persist into adulthood.
Q4: Are private assessments recognized by the NHS?
A: While private assessments are legitimate, individuals may still need to provide supporting files to NHS practitioners if they desire to pursue treatment within the NHS framework.
Q5: How long does a private assessment take?
A: The real assessment may take between 1 to 3 hours, but the whole process, consisting of follow-up appointments and reports, can take a couple of weeks.
